Output 43e6bb2b15638f8a3131e434ae8b386a98b02fd941d5b39feacdefca85141b60:0

value
154485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7983bba573569f1ce561684289c1b26a1cf47f OP_EQUAL
address
3QhymsC8F6FGyZTNtHiLURaVj7kyqurvSL
transaction
43e6bb2b15638f8a3131e434ae8b386a98b02fd941d5b39feacdefca85141b60
spent
true